This stunning print captures the grandeur and beauty of the Mississippi State Capitol in Jackson, USA. Built in 1901 by architect Theodore C. Link, this architectural masterpiece is a prime example of Beaux Arts style with its intricate details and decorative elements.
The golden dome of the capitol building gleams in the sunlight, while an eagle sculpture perched atop adds a touch of regal elegance. The marble exterior exudes a sense of power and authority, fitting for a structure that houses the Mississippi Legislature.
